POTLATCH NO1 FINANCIAL CREDIT UNION, founded in 2019, is a major nonprofit in the Public & Societal Benefit sector that reported $149.6M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ue grew 9%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ion.

Mission

WE PLEDGE TO SERVE EVERY MEMBER WITH THE HIGHEST LEVEL OF SINCERITY, FAIRNESS, COURTESY, RESPECT, AND GRATITUDE, DELIVERED WITH UNPARALLELED RESPONSIVENESS, EXPERTISE, EFFICIENCY AND ACCURACY.

Note: Compensation data is self-reported by the organization on their Form 990. "Reportable Comp" includes salary, bonuses, and other reportable compensation from the organization and related organizations. "Other Comp" includes benefits, deferred compensation, and non-taxable benefits.
